1. A fraud notification platform for updating a security model using real-time feedback from a user device, the platform comprising:
one or more non-transitory memories configured to store instructions and data; and
one or more processors, coupled to the one or more memories, configured to execute the instructions to:
receive, from the user device, user data that indicates at least one of a credential of a card associated with a user of the user device or an identifier associated with the user device;
receive an indication of an exchange initiated using the credential of the card associated with the user data, wherein the indication identifies exchange data associated with the exchange;
determine, using the security model, a score associated with the exchange based on the exchange data, wherein the score indicates a likelihood that the exchange is valid, wherein the security model comprises a machine learning model trained using real-time feedback and location data to enhance fraud detection accuracy;
transmit, to the user device, a notification based on the score satisfying a first threshold,
wherein the notification requests an indication of whether the exchange is valid regardless of whether the score satisfies a second threshold that is higher than the first threshold, wherein the exchange is enabled to be completed in instances where the score satisfies the first threshold and does not satisfy the second threshold;
receive, from the user device, a response to the notification indicating whether the exchange is valid, wherein the response indicates user device location information associated with the user device;
compare a user device location indicated by the user device location information with an exchange location indicated by the exchange data, wherein the exchange location comprises geographic coordinates associated with the exchange;
determine whether the response is valid based on comparing the user device location and the exchange location; and
update the security model in real-time using an initial determination of the score and an indication of whether the exchange is valid that is based on the response to the notification and whether the response is valid, wherein the updating includes dynamically adjusting model parameters to improve fraud detection accuracy and system security by deploying and training the security model.
